Wildfires session at EGU 2008

13-18 April 2008, Vienna, Austria


Within the frame of the European Geosciences Union (EGU) General Assembly 2008 from 13-18 April 2008 in Vienna, Austria, there will be a special session ‘Spatial and temporal patterns of wildfires: models, theory, and reality’ (NH8.4/BG2.16 – co-organized by the Natural Hazards & Biogeosciences divisions).

Session description:
Wildfires are the result of a large variety and number of interacting components, producing patterns that vary significantly both spatially and temporally. This session will examine models, theory, and empirical studies in wildfire research. Submissions in any one or combination of these three main areas are encouraged, and it is envisioned bringing together wildfire hazard managers, applied researchers, and theoreticians.
Posters are also very much encouraged, as it is planned to have both lively oral and poster sessions.

The best papers will be considered for publication in a Special Issue of Ecological Modelling
